Adjusting the Volume

 

Choose from four ringer volume settings (off, low, medium,

Ringer

and high). With the phone in standby, use [

] to make

Volume

the ringer volume louder or [ ] to make it softer or turn it

 

completely off.

 

 

 

Earpiece

Choose from six volume levels for the earpiece. While on

a call, press [ ] to make the earpiece volume louder or

Volume

[

] to make it softer.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Choose from six volume levels for the handset

 

Speaker

speakerphone. While on a speakerphone call, press

Volume

[

] to make the speaker volume louder or [

] to make

 

it softer.
